    My childhood home..  — 2 years ago

    I grew up in a little house just north of the University Village in Seattle, a tiny red house built in 1910. Four years ago, I was driving by the house and noticed it was for sale. So I called the realtor to make an appointment to see the house. My goodness.. 45 years hadn’t changed a lot. The living room, kitchen and dining room had been changed some. But the basement looked EXACTLY the same. And the bathroom even had the same green bathtub that was thre when I was a kid. What really shocked me was that they were selling a 90 year old 700 sq ft house for $260,000!!! We could barely get that for our four bedroom, four bathroom 3600 sq ft house (with two kitchens) in Lynnwood!!!

    So, I can it’s both true and untrue, that you can go home again…
